Anindya Chatterjee is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Mechanics of Materials and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Anindya Chatterjee has authored 84 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Control and Systems Engineering, 20 papers in Mechanics of Materials and 14 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Anindya Chatterjee’s work include Dynamics and Control of Mechanical Systems (9 papers), Fractional Differential Equations Solutions (9 papers) and Adhesion, Friction, and Surface Interactions (8 papers). Anindya Chatterjee is often cited by papers focused on Dynamics and Control of Mechanical Systems (9 papers), Fractional Differential Equations Solutions (9 papers) and Adhesion, Friction, and Surface Interactions (8 papers). Anindya Chatterjee coll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and United Kingdom. Anindya Chatterjee's co-authors include Andy Ruina, Mariano Matilla García, Michael D. Coleman, Pankaj Wahi, Michael J. Coleman, Subrahmanyam Gorthi, Joseph P. Cusumano, Kutty Selva Nandakumar, Sovan Lal Das and Marian Wiercigroch and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Chemical Physics, Scientific Reports and IEEE Transactions on Information Theory.
